I think I'm -1 for this. It feels like something that should exist in a
utility library rather than in the standard one.

I do have an honest question that comes from ignorance rather than malice:
has anyone actually used .times in ruby outside of the context of learning
or testing? I've written a fair amount of ruby and I don't think I've ever
seen it in production code. It is definitely a cleaner construct for what
it's trying to do, but I'm having trouble convincing myself it's a common
enough pattern to justify it being standard.

> Dear Swift-Community,
>
> I’d like to propose an addition of a useful method, especially for
> beginners that also makes Swift much more readable in some situations: The
> addition of a .times method to Integer type(s).
>
> For example recently in one of my projects I wanted to test the
> scalability of an important piece of code and wrote this method:
>
>    func testPerfQualityInPercentWithoutQualityImprovements() {
>        self.measureBlock {
>            let expectedQuality = 33.33
>            0.stride(to: 5_000, by: 1).forEach { _ in
>                XCTAssertEqualWithAccuracy(self.crossword.qualityInPercent,
> expectedQuality, accuracy: 0.1)
>            }
>        }
>    }
>
> As you can see what I basically wanted was to repeat the test some
> thousand times. I also like to use the Ruby language and one thing I love
> about it is that it has some really handy methods integrated to the
> language in situations like this which make the code very readable and
> therefore fun to use.
>
> I’m an even bigger fan of Swift so I’d love to see such useful methods
> appear in Swift, too and this is the first I came across that I really
> missed. So I’m asking myself, what if I could write the same code above
> like this:
>
>    func testPerfQualityInPercentWithoutQualityImprovements() {
>        self.measureBlock {
>            let expectedQuality = 33.33
>            5_000.times {
>                XCTAssertEqualWithAccuracy(self.crossword.qualityInPercent,
> expectedQuality, accuracy: 0.1)
>            }
>        }
>    }
>
> I think it could be added to the Swift standard library very easily (for
> example by using the .stride method like I used) without any side effects
> and has enough advantages to be part of Swift itself. What do you think?
